Results are fast
If you place a bet on a tennis match, you face hours waiting to find out if you’ve won. Then there’s golf where you could be waiting days to find out the same. While betting on these sports has its appeal, for some fans of gambling, the fact that it’s all just so drawn out is a real turn-off. That’s where UFC comes in.
UFC matches are short. With rounds only lasting five minutes, you don’t have long to wait to see if your wager has come good. Generally, you’ll know just what you’ve won, or lost, in no more than 20 minutes.
